Job Description – Site Construction Manager (HVDC Interconnector Project)

Location: Scotland
Project: HVDC Interconnector
Duration: 3 year contract

Role Overview

We are seeking an experienced Site Construction Manager to oversee and deliver site-based construction activities for the High Voltage Direct Current (HVDC) Interconnector Project In Scotland. This role will involve managing civil, electrical, and mechanical works across HVDC converter stations, substations, and associated infrastructure.

The Site Construction Manager will ensure works are executed safely, on time, within budget, and to the highest technical and quality standards, working within a joint venture/consortium framework. The position requires close collaboration with National Grid and other stakeholders, ensuring compliance with statutory regulations, project specifications, and industry best practices.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and manage all site construction activities, including civil, structural, electrical, and mechanical scopes.
  • Oversee the safe execution of works in line with CDM Regulations, site safety plans, and company HSE policies.
  • Coordinate with design, engineering, and procurement teams to ensure smooth project delivery.
  • Manage construction schedules, resources, subcontractors, and logistics to meet project milestones.
  • Interface directly with National Grid and other regulatory stakeholders, ensuring compliance with standards and project requirements.
  • Supervise and direct subcontractors, ensuring alignment with project specifications and quality requirements.
  • Ensure site activities align with project budget, programme, and risk management frameworks.
  • Report progress, risks, and issues to project leadership.
  • Foster strong working relationships across joint venture/consortium partners to ensure seamless delivery.
  • Support commissioning teams during energisation and handover phases.
